Description:

Double Helix Jinx Rod is a lampworking color rod manufactured as a solid, colored glass rod intended for torch work such as beads, pendants, marbles, and small sculptural components. Double Helix colors are used when you want specialty effects that develop through heatwork and flame chemistry, producing shifts in tone, depth, and surface character that standard transparent and opaque colors do not provide. Jinx is commonly chosen as a reactive color that can be used as a base, as striping, or as surface decoration when you want complex visual results that respond to controlled heating and flame adjustments.

How it is used:

Introduce the rod to the flame gradually to prevent thermal shock, then heat to a workable glow and apply it to your piece as a base layer, wrap, or surface design. Use steady heat for smooth application, then adjust flame chemistry and working temperature to develop the reactive effects. Allow the piece to even out at temperature to stabilize the surface, then place it into a kiln and anneal using a schedule appropriate for the glass you are working.

For Best Results: Higher temperatures and longer annealing times can initiate further opacification of the opal. Encasing the Opal will also add heat and time so adjust your annealing accordingly or plan on having more opacity. We recommend using moderately thin layers of the color and annealing at 925F.
